Webrehabilitation centers, and nursing homes [19]. The wide range of activities related to healing gardens may be passive or active: looking at the garden from a window, sitting, eating reading, doing paperwork or taking a nap in the garden, prayer and meditation, walking to a preferred spot, gardening, exercise and sports, and children’s play [20]. Use the Gardens and outdoor spaces checklis t to check your facility for dementia-friendly outdoor design and approaches. Create separate outdoor areas for activities, socialising and quiet times by putting furniture in suitable places under shade, along paths, near garden beds and beside trees.
